Off Limits
"Being a cop is tough. But in Saigon, 1968, being a cop is crazy."
Originally released in 1988. Off Limits is a action/crime film. directed by Christopher Crowe.
Starring Willem Dafoe, Gregory Hines, and Fred Ward
Synopsis
McGriff and Albaby are probably doing the worst law enforcement job in the world - they are plain clothes U.S. military policemen on duty in war-time Saigon. However, their job becomes even harder when they start investigating the serial killings of local prostitutes. Their prime suspect is high ranking U.S. Army officer which brings their lives in danger.
